It appears asymmetric- the number of legs is different on the 2 sides. Did you squish it before the photo. If its a cockroach- boric acid sprinkled behind appliances where your dog can't get to it is effective (at least in NYC). Totally gross wherever it is.
i heard sprinkling the borax under appliances works too.

joeyddog - NYC had German Cockroaches. BELIEVE ME you'd rather have these big suckers! If you see 1 german cockroach you can bet there are a million. You know the old "flick on the lights and see them scurry" gross! If you see 1 american cockroach it is what it is, you kill it and it's done with!
